Ghostheart was amongst the latest urban legends to find life in Norneau’s busy scene.

Buoyed by those who claimed freedom thanks to his activities, and the influx of beastfolk from the west, hungry to learn more about a city that managed to fend off Maledict, the Duke of Heresy’s siege, the story spread like wildfire.

Some wanted to fight the mysterious demon, believing that he had stolen much of the Syndicate’s former wealth in the city. Others claimed he delivered warnings to those wished to own slaves. And still, others claimed that he could be summoned, with the humble use of magic to create a blue flame, and that those seeking emancipation for someone in the city would be met, while those seeking a fight would find one, and lose.

It was a blue flame rumor that Kir was investigating tonight.

Since his second strike against the Syndicate, Ghostheart had become the most hunted being in the city. Not just because of his activities, but because of what he’d inspired. Slaveowners dispossessed themselves of their slaves after he started targeting the locals. Those who didn’t started to be targeted by locals who believed in abolition.

Lumin’s influence meant the city was acted to purchase the contracts and immediately release the slaves, even hiring them for construction and sponsoring them into businesses to replace those lost by fleeing citizens during the siege.

But one of the entities Norneau had purchased from was the Syndicate, just before Kir’s second strike that killed all but the leader of the Syndicate office. It was an attack that left the man fundamentally unable to retrieve the gold he’d been paid, since Ghostheart’s frequent "appearances" at the harbor meant no Captain would carry it. Those foolish enough to try had been identified to Kir, who had paid each a... discouraging visit.

Tonight, it was a middle-aged houndkin woman who was carrying a lamp that emitted a bright blue flame. Watching her for a time, Kir saw she was walking in a circle from the docks to the main street.

Manasight told him that she was only channeling enough power to keep the flame alight. With a city as active as Norneau, it was just another light amongst many, but more than a few patrons of bars and night walkers noted her passing with looks of curiosity or disdain.

For a months-old urban legend, this Ghostheart thing has wings.

"You’re telling me," Kiryu replied to the thought without prompting.
